The Montreal Event Market

Montreal is Canada's premier events destination—the city hosted over 3,000 events in 2023 across the Palais des congrès, Bell Centre, and iconic cultural venues. The city's bilingual culture (French-English) is non-negotiable for staffing; Quebec Bill 101 language requirements often mandate French-first communication. Major industries driving events include pharmaceuticals, tech startups (AI and software), fashion, and international conferences. The city's vibrant festival culture (Jazz Fest, Just for Laughs, International Film Festival) creates immense summer demand. Winter event volume increases with holiday corporate galas and indoor conferences.

Montreal’s Global Event Market: Bilingual Excellence and Cultural Leadership

Montreal is a global center for business, arts, and culture, creating a sophisticated, multilingual event market. The city’s mandatory French-English bilingualism distinguishes it from other North American event markets. International conferences, film festivals, and cultural productions dominate the event calendar. Event professionals must demonstrate fluent bilingual capability and understanding of Quebec’s unique cultural context.

Year-Round International and Cultural Event Demand

Spring and fall bring international business conferences and trade shows. Summer features music festivals, arts celebrations, and outdoor events. Winter supports holiday galas, film industry events, and winter festival productions. Consistent international business demand provides year-round opportunities for bilingual event professionals.

Bilingual Staffing and Multilingual Expertise

Fluent French-English bilingual capability is mandatory for Montreal event staffing and commands premium compensation. Additional language skills (Spanish, Mandarin) add value for international events. Building relationships with Montreal’s bilingual hospitality programs and international associations strengthens recruitment for sophisticated international events.
